Product details

47 µH shielded ferrite-core inductor for automotive power rails

The Murata LQH2MPZ470MGRL is a 47 µH drum core wirewound inductor in the LQH2 series, shielded for reduced EMI coupling into adjacent traces. The 180 mA continuous current rating and 6.36 Ohm max DCR define the DC loss budget — at full rated current the self-heating from DCR is roughly 0.2 W, which stays within the 0806 package's thermal limits below 105 °C ambient.

Saturation headroom and self-resonant frequency

The saturation current (Isat) is 270 mA, giving 50 % headroom above the 180 mA rated current — a DC-DC converter with a 150 mA load ripple that peaks at 200 mA still stays below the inductance roll-off knee. The self-resonant frequency is 10 MHz, which sets the usable frequency ceiling: above 10 MHz the inductor behaves capacitively, so it suits switching converters switching at 1–3 MHz where the fundamental and first few harmonics stay below SRF.
